Porlock’s summer vibe feels different this year—fewer open-top bus rides mean fewer tourists sticking around and spending in local shops and cafes. Locals say the once-busy Exmoor Explorer bus, now running less often and with a roof, just isn’t the same draw. Visitors are shortening their stays and watching their wallets more closely, and business owners are feeling the pinch. For many, the open-top bus was a highlight of the trip.
